Output 99356d6fc2d64eb9d63afcead0e8177a7ad4a8f461eae50265732f6d2e9bf016:0

value
3343500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c56b902ee0a56a9c2295c77982cc009d231181 OP_EQUAL
address
3EcdhavNQHBrCEh49gte3qiVf2vZMwuy52
transaction
99356d6fc2d64eb9d63afcead0e8177a7ad4a8f461eae50265732f6d2e9bf016
spent
true